Mamografie cu Tomosinteza

Mammography is an essential examination in the prevention of breast cancer, which is the most common type of cancer in Europe and which can be successfully treated if detected early.
It is easy to perform because it uses low doses of X-rays, which allow the detection of tumor formations long before they can be clinically identified.
TOMOSYNTHESIS provides additional images by analyzing the breast from different angles, thus being superior to a standard mammogram.
Women over the age of 40 should have a mammogram annually, or even earlier when there are signs suggesting breast involvement.
